1. Safety First

Removing a big tree is dangerous business. Cutting and removing an old tree without the right equipment, safety harness, and experience can be fatal, and you should leave it to professionals who can take care of everything. Heavy branches can fall on passersby, buildings, sidewalks, vehicles, or utility lines. Animals and birds may also be living in the tree, creating additional risks during removal. When you hire a professional tree removal company, they assess safety hazards beforehand and take precautions to avoid them. Large, damaged, and overgrown branches can harm you and your property if left untreated. 3. Mitigate Damage

Cutting an overgrown tree on your own can damage nearby plants, driveways, buildings, fences, utility areas, or neighboring property. Rotten branches can fall unexpectedly and cause expensive repairs. Old roots can also create problems near foundations, plumbing, sidewalks, and sewer lines if removal is handled incorrectly. Tree removal experts are equipped to evaluate these risks and remove trees with less impact on the surrounding property. Proper planning helps reduce damage to landscaping, structures, underground utilities, and nearby trees. Arborist Services

Hiring a professional arborist can ensure that your trees are well-maintained and healthy. Arborists specialize in the care of individual trees, offering services such as pruning, disease diagnosis, and treatment. They can help you make informed decisions about the care and maintenance of your trees, ensuring that they continue to enhance the beauty and value of your property. FAQ About Professional Tree Removal Services

When is tree removal necessary?

Tree removal may be necessary when a tree is dead, unstable, storm-damaged, leaning dangerously, or too close to buildings, walkways, vehicles, or utility lines.

Why hire a professional tree removal service?

Professionals have the training, equipment, and safety procedures needed to remove hazardous trees while reducing risks to people and property.

Can tree pruning fix a hazardous tree?

Tree pruning can remove unsafe limbs, but full removal may be needed if the trunk, roots, or overall structure is severely damaged.

Does tree removal include cleanup?

Many tree services include cleanup, removing branches, wood chips, leaves, and debris after the tree is taken down.

Why is stump removal important?

Stump removal helps prevent tripping hazards, pest issues, landscaping problems, and unwanted regrowth.

What should homeowners do after storm damage?

Homeowners should stay away from damaged trees, especially near power lines, and call a professional tree service for assessment and cleanup.
